Ingredients for BLT Pasta Salad:
Bring a delightful twist to your picnic with this BLT Pasta Salad. Prepare by gathering the following ingredients:
- 1/2 cup plain Greek yogurt or sour cream
- 1/3 cup mayonnaise
- 2 tablespoons buttermilk
- 1 cup fresh basil leaves
- 1/2 cup fresh cilantro
- 1/4 cup chopped fresh chives
- 1 jalapeño, seeded if desired
- 2 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- Kosher salt and black pepper, to taste
- 1 pound short cut pasta
- 1 cup cubed spicy cheddar cheese
- 1 head romaine lettuce, shredded
- 2 cups cherry tomatoes, halved
- 2 cups grilled corn (approximately 3 ears)
- 8 slices cooked bacon, crumbled
- 1 avocado, diced

How to Prepare:
To create a delightful BLT Pasta Salad, start by making the zesty jalapeño ranch dressing. Blend half a cup of plain Greek yogurt or sour cream, a third cup of mayonnaise, and two tablespoons of buttermilk in a blender. Add one cup of fresh basil, half a cup of cilantro, a quarter cup of chives, and a seeded jalapeño for kick. Include Worcestershire sauce, garlic powder, onion powder, and season with kosher salt and black pepper to taste, then blend until smooth.
Next, boil one pound of short cut pasta in salted water until al dente and drain. In a spacious serving bowl, combine the warm pasta with the homemade dressing and stir in cubed spicy cheddar cheese. Add shredded romaine lettuce, grilled corn, crumbled bacon, and diced avocado, tossing gently to integrate. Serve this mouthwatering salad warm or chilled, allowing flavors to meld beautifully. Storage Tips for BLT Pasta Salad:
To keep your delicious BLT Pasta Salad fresh, store it in an airtight container in the refrigerator. Typically, it lasts up to three days. How long can I store leftovers?
Leftover BLT Pasta Salad can typically be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for about 3 to 4 days. However, the freshness of the lettuce may decrease, so it’s best enjoyed within a couple of days.
Is BLT Pasta Salad suitable for meal prep?
Yes, it’s perfect for meal prep! Assembling the salad in advance allows the flavors to meld together. Just keep the lettuce separate until serving for optimal crispness.
Can I make this salad vegetarian?
Certainly! To create a vegetarian version of the BLT Pasta Salad, substitute the bacon with smoked tempeh or crispy tofu. This provides a similar texture while keeping the salad hearty and satisfying.
